Davante Adams and J.K. Dobbins have been on opposite sides of 24 real dynasty trades.
Not simulations and not a calculator lining up two numbers. Every one of them is a completed trade from a public Sleeper league, graded at the player values that were current on the day it happened.
None of them were a straight one-for-one. Every time these two crossed, something else was attached to close it.
In 1 of these deals exactly one side had to attach something extra, split 0 to 1 between the Davante Adams side and the J.K. Dobbins side. That is too close, and too small a sample, to call either player the more valuable.
Everything above is priced on the day each deal happened, which is the only honest way to grade a completed trade. It is not what they cost now. Today Davante Adams prices at 1,064 and J.K. Dobbins at 291, so the market currently rates Davante Adams about 3.7x the other. A pair can lean one way across its history and price the opposite way now; that gap is the whole reason to check the deal in front of you rather than the deal someone made in 2023.
Values as of 2026-07-24.

Read each row as: Davante Adams, plus anything in the third column, was traded for J.K. Dobbins plus anything in the fourth. An em dash means that side sent nobody else. Margin is the value gap at that day’s prices from the side that received Davante Adams; positive means that side came out ahead.
Across all 24, the whole-deal value gap runs +10.9% from the side that received Davante Adams, so the side ending up with Davante Adams has generally come out ahead on face value. That measures the entire trade, every piece included, not these two players against each other.
A calculator answers “is Davante Adams for J.K. Dobbins fair” by subtracting one number from another, and it gives every manager in your league the same answer. That tells you nothing about whether the trade closes. What closes it is whether one side has to attach a piece, and which side that usually is. The 24 deals above are the record of what leagues actually agreed to when these two were on the table together.
